Transaction ce21778d3b94f405d38d50605f510014873bf060d8e404f98bec5cab2f071fca
1 Input
1 Output
-
ce21778d3b94f405d38d50605f510014873bf060d8e404f98bec5cab2f071fca:0
- value
- 138519221
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2487742e12c4d5b973589c3ff77a64aa7153fe99 OP_EQUAL
- address
- MBEJpqGdUKbjs9oVvg3BjFM6Bgfc2SY9LK